Japanese American Military Experience Database

Arthur T. "Art" Yoshimura

Gender
Male
Birth date
1922-7-16
Place of birth
Phoenix AZ, U.S.A.
Inducted
1943-5-12, Salt Lake City UT
Enlistment type
Volunteer
Service branch
Army
Service type
War
Unit type
Combat
Units served
442nd Regimental Combat Team, F Company
522nd Field Artillery, A Battery
Military specialty
Cannoneer 531
Stationed
USA: Mississippi
Other Countries: Italy, France
Separated
Brigham City UT
Unit responsibility
Artillery
Personal responsibility
Served on 105mm howitzer gun crew in training and in combat - maintained and repaired gun.
Major battles (if served in a war zone)
Rome - Arno and German Campaigns - as artilleryman
Battle of Bruyeres and Lost Battalion - as infantryman Sept/Oct '44
Awards, medals, citations (individual or unit)
Good Conduct Ribbon
Purple Heart
Combat Infantryman Badge
Two Bronze Camapign Stars
European Middle Eastern African Theatre of War Ribbons
